Onboarding: Catalogue Import (Brindleshelf)

Nightly import pulls records into the Brindleshelf staging catalogue. Dedup runs after ingest; failures go to the import queue dashboard. Do not re-run imports mid-cycle. If the importer stalls and locks the staging index, unseal it manually and flag it at eng sync. Unseal passphrase follows.

unlock words, yawig-kagef: gordor-holvan-ulaael-pramir-ulaiel-tamdor

Short version: compaction keeps only the latest record per key, so support tickets about "missing messages" on compacted topics are usually working as intended. Check the topic's cleanup policy before escalating. Tombstones are retained for the configured grace window, then dropped — consumers that lag past that window will miss deletions. Compaction lag spikes during broker restarts are normal for up to an hour. Detailed behavior, tuning knobs, and common ticket patterns are documented on the internal page.

dashboard of bafof-hafog = https://confluence.lumiclabs.internal/display/browse/display/6a09a20a

**Q: How is the Slatebridge timetable solver's admin console protected?**

A: Solver runs are sandboxed. Input constraint files are validated before scheduling. Admin console requires hardware token plus the rotation passphrase. No student records leave the Fernhollow cluster. Audit logs are immutable for 90 days. For your review environment only, the console has been provisioned with a temporary credential. Authenticate to the review instance with the passphrase below.

unlock words, hahip-baduf: holwyn-istath-julvan

## Deployment

The Lumacache image service has a known slow leak in its thumbnail cache layer: evicted entries keep a reference alive through the decoder pool, so resident memory creeps up roughly 40 MB per hour under steady load. Until the refactor in the Harkness branch lands, we mitigate by capping pool size and scheduling a rolling restart every 12 hours. Deploy with the supervisor, never bare, or the restart hook won't fire. The deployment relies on the configuration values listed below.

settings of bagug-tahof:
holath:
  pin: 7837
  metrics_host: metrics.holath.tolvaqsys.internal
  tenant: quenath
  seal: seal_6001b3af